Position Details

Position Type: Full‑Time
Schedule: Overnight from Monday – Thursday, 7:30 pm – 6:00 am
Pay: $20 – $23 /hr

Overview

Step into the heart of healthcare innovation with Strive Pharmacy. As a Pharmacy Technician – Fulfillment, you’ll play a crucial role in helping patients receive the best care available. Your precision and dedication will ensure compliance and excellence, directly impacting patient outcomes and sat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ities
  • Champion Healthcare Excellence: Engage in our dynamic production fulfillment zones, meeting and exceeding KPIs to ensure best care.
  • Master Technical Precision: Maintain high standards; process every prescription with accuracy and care.
  • Scale Your Impact: Grow through three performance levels:
    Beginner (50–100 prescriptions/day), Intermediate (100–175 prescriptions/day), Advanced (175+ prescriptions/day).
Required Qualifications
  • Completion of a GED or high‑school diploma.
  • An active State Technician and PTCB license (or Technician Trainee license).
  • Ability to lift up to 50 pounds.
Desired Skills
  • Technical Proficiency: Demonstrated computer skills, comfortable with our state‑of‑the‑art systems.
  • Pharmaceutical Expertise: Completion of a recognized Pharmacy Technician Certification Program (PTCP) is valued.
  • Experience: Prior pharmacy setting experience with proven accuracy in data entry.
  • Attention to Detail: Meticulousness ensuring high quality care.
  • Customer Service Excellence: Strong background in customer service, seeing each interaction as an opportunity to positively impact patients.
Benefits/Perks

Comprehensive benefits including employer‑paid healthcare coverage after 30 days, choice of an FSA/HSA, voucher for new‑hire scrubs (if applicable), parental leave, a 401(k) plan with matching contributions, and weekends/holidays off.
